Cleaning a split-system air conditioner helps it run more efficiently, maintain good air quality, and extend its lifespan. Although it is generally advisable to have a professional perform deep cleanings annually, there are several basic steps you can safely do yourself at home. Below is a general guide on how to clean both the indoor and outdoor units.
Important: If you are uncertain or not comfortable performing any of these steps, consult a licensed HVAC professional. Always refer to your specific unit’s manual for any model-specific instructions.
1. Warning
●Before the cleaning of the air conditioner, it must be shut down and the electricity must be cut off for more than 5 minutes, otherwise there might be the risk of electric shocks.
●Do not wet the air conditioner, which can cause an electric shock. Make sure not to rinse the air conditioner with water under any circumstances.
●Volatile liquids such as thinner or gasoline will damage the air conditioner housing, therefore please clean the housing of air conditioner only with soft dry cloth and damp cloth moistened with neutral detergent.
●In the course of the usage, pay attention to cleaning the filter regularly, to prevent the accumulation of dust which may affect the air conditioner performance . If the service environment of the air conditioner is dusty, correspondingly increase the number of times of cleaning. After removing the filter, do not touch the fin part of the indoor unit with the finger, and no force to damage the refrigerant pipeline.
2. Clean the panel

When the panel of the indoor unit is contaminated, clean it gently with a wrung towel using tepid water below 40"C, and do not remove the panel while cleaning.
3. Clean the air filter

3.1 Remove the air filter
1. Use both hands to open the panel for an angle from both ends of the panel in accordance with the direction of the arrow.
2. Release the air filter from the slot and remove it.

The air filter is locate above the fuselage.
Take it out facing upward.
3.2 Clean the Air Filter

Use a vacuum cleaner or water to rinse the filter, and if the filter is very dirty (for example, with greasy dirt), clean it with warm water (below 45 C ) with mild detergent,and then put the filter in the shade to dry in the air.
3.3 Mount the Filter

Reinstall the dried filter in reverse order of removal, then cover and lock the panel.

4. Check before using
1. Check whether all the air inlets and outlets of the units are unblocked.
2. Check whether there is blocking in the water outlet of the drain pipe, and immediately clean it up if any.
3. Check the ground wire is reliably grounded.
4. Check whether the remote control batteries are installed, and whether the power is sufficient.
5. Check whether there is damage in the mounting bracket of the outdoor unit, and if any, please contact our local service center.
5. Maintain after using
1. Cut off the power source of the air conditioner, turn off the main power switch and remove the batteries from the remote controller.
2. Clean the filter and the unit body.
3. Remove the dust and debris from the outdoor unit.
4. Check whether there is damage in the mounting bracket of the outdoor unit, and if any, please contact our local service center.
